Anna Wintour's farewell to Vogue US is here, and the internet has *thoughts*! Debuting as the cover star for Vogue's latest issue, Timothée Chalamet, a third male to grace the cover, is photographed by Annie Lebovitz, a long-time collaborator of Wintour. Céline outfits complete the look, a brand that resonates with current trends.
The cover also features an image from NASA, a first for Vogue. Despite the star power and innovative elements, the magazine's final cover under Anna Wintour's editorial helm has been met with widespread criticism, sparking a flurry of online mockery.
Inside the magazine, however, a fashion edit and interview with Chalamet showcase a more cohesive vision. The striking cover, despite its polarizing reception, is undoubtedly memorable and poised to become a pop culture moment.
